I am thinking that ADAM would have never become the Hero he was fabled to be if Hiro had not intervened and pointed him towards Heroism, he was a lout to begin with and would have proceeded along that path, he had no reason to change until Hiro introduced him to the Legendary Stories.
The Honorable side of this lout never came forward until guided by Hiro. This makes me believe Hiro had to intervene or the storys could have never been written, the way they were. They would have been stories about a jerk doin jerky things. Hiro would have grown up as a child with no story of a Heroic Legendary Kensei.
I think Adam was always a Profiteer and a swindler out for himself. The fact that a boy had been raised on stories of a Hero, went back in time, and initiated a change in Adam to be the Hero, was the only reason the Legends were even started.
This is what sets up What i call an Eternal Loop, kinda like "You made me", but for you to do that, "I had to make You first" all a total impossibility ( but we are dealing with fiction {ain't it great?} )
This means to me, that the Adam we see is still the same Adam only increasingly Jerkier and with a 400 year grudge to settle, and that Kensei is only fable and legend, even though at one time Adam , for a short period, claimed the name Kensei, he was only the start of the Heroic Legend. |

Secondly Hiro did not go back into time with Kensei's sword. If you recall in the season finale, Hiro brought Ando back to the office before the "big showdown" and let him keep Kensei's sword b/c as he tells Ando "the sword doesn't make the hiro"... He ended up taking that blue sword he had with him.
As further proof that he didn't have Kensei's sword when he went back in time is that Ando this season was reading the scrolls left in Kensei's sword by Hiro. If Hiro had it with him, Ando wouldn't have it. |
